Flash has been discontinued by Adobe and Microsoft have disabled it in Windows as of today.

This means that our screensavers  no longer work as they were created using flash (.swf) files with InstantStorm. Users will now receive a white screen when the screensaver starts.

What are our options? We created the .swf in Adobe Animate. Then converted to .scr using Instant Storm.
